Choco Mucho survives ZUS Coffee to move forward in PVL Play-Ins

Choco Mucho mustered enough strength to power through a 21-25, 25-22, 13-25, 25-11, 15-11 victory over ZUS Coffee, taking the next step in the 2026 PVL All-Filipino Conference play-in stage on Tuesday at the Filoil Centre.

The seventh-ranked Flying Titans will next face No. 6 Akari Chargers in the next phase of the stepladder play-ins on Saturday at the Ninoy Aquino Stadium.

“Bago pa mag-umpisa ng game, sinabi ko na sa kanila na all out na tayo, kasi wala nang bukas. Ayun nga, ito nangyari, sinubukan nga kami hanggang dulo. Nakuha namin ‘yung game and pagdating nung fourth set and fifth set nakuha namin ‘yung game,” said Choco Mucho head coach Dante Alinsunurin.

After being crushed in the third set, 25-13, the Flying Titans showed their resilience by thrashing the Thunderbelles 25-11 in the fourth set to level the match at two sets apiece.

From there, the momentum never shifted, as Eya Laure, Sisi Rondina, and Maddie Madayag combined efforts to give Choco Mucho a commanding 12-5 lead in the deciding set.

Although Kate Santiago tried to turn the tide for ZUS Coffee, Kat Tolentino and Rondina were there to put the finishing touches, sealing the win in one hour and 57 minutes.

Rondina led the charge with 27 points, built on 26 attacks, along with 15 excellent receptions and 10 digs.

Madayag also went on a rampage, scoring 19 points on 14-of-22 attacks, plus three blocks and two aces, while Laure added 13 points in four sets played.

Deanna Wong delivered 24 excellent sets, while Kat Tolentino contributed 12 points and 10 digs.

Meanwhile, the Thunderbelles struggled to find their footing throughout the tournament, winning only one game in 10 matches.

Their wing spikers failed to make a significant impact, leaving middle blockers Riza Nogales and Thea Gagate to lead the team with 16 and 12 points, respectively.
